在当今的计算机技术领域,插件已经成为许多软件不可或缺的一部分。PRCC(Python Robotics Control Center)作为一个专注于机器人控制的平台,同样支持插件功能,让用户可以根据自己的需求扩展软件的功能。下面,我们就来详细讲解如何轻松上手PRCC插件应用,只需四大步骤,让你轻松解锁插件应用技巧。
步骤一:了解PRCC插件系统
首先,你需要了解PRCC的插件系统。PRCC的插件系统是基于Python编写的,因此,你需要对Python有一定的了解。插件通常以Python模块的形式存在,它们可以被PRCC调用,以实现特定的功能。
1.1 插件类型
PRCC支持多种类型的插件,包括但不限于:
- 控制插件:用于控制机器人运动、传感器读取等。
- 显示插件:用于在PRCC界面中显示图形、图表等。
- 数据处理插件:用于对机器人收集的数据进行处理和分析。
1.2 插件安装
PRCC插件通常需要从官方仓库或第三方源安装。你可以通过以下命令安装插件:
pip install prcc-plugin-name
步骤二:编写插件代码
编写插件代码是使用PRCC插件的关键步骤。以下是一个简单的插件代码示例,用于读取传感器数据:
import prcc
class SensorPlugin(prcc.Plugin):
def __init__(self):
super().__init__()
def run(self):
sensor_data = self.read_sensor()
self.display_data(sensor_data)
def read_sensor(self):
# 读取传感器数据
return {"temperature": 25, "humidity": 50}
def display_data(self, data):
# 显示传感器数据
print("Temperature: {}°C".format(data["temperature"]))
print("Humidity: {}%".format(data["humidity"]))
步骤三:加载插件
编写完插件代码后,你需要将其加载到PRCC中。这可以通过以下命令实现:
prcc.load_plugin("SensorPlugin")
加载插件后,你可以在PRCC界面中看到相应的插件选项。
步骤四:使用插件
最后,你可以通过PRCC界面使用插件。以下是一个使用传感器插件的示例:
- 在PRCC界面中,选择“传感器”插件。
- 点击“读取数据”按钮,插件将读取传感器数据并显示在界面上。
通过以上四大步骤,你就可以轻松上手PRCC插件应用了。希望本文能帮助你更好地了解PRCC插件系统,发挥其强大的功能。
